Mike Douglas and Shirley Temple talk to "Big Eyes" painter Margaret Keane in 1972

Sorry the site has been on a bit of a holiday hiatus, but I did want to point out this great interview with Margaret Keane, the subject of Tim Burton's new film BIG EYES.  It's a testament to the ability of Amy Adams, who plays Keane in the film, as Keane's reluctant, people-pleasing nature is so evident in the film itself.  Here, Douglas talks to her about her story, her influences, and how she came out from under her husband's shadow.

Carol Channing and Teresa Graves perform "Soul Sister" on "Laugh-In"

I'd point out the talents of the late Teresa Graves, who was a regular "Laugh-In" performer before playing the lead in 1974's "Get Christie Love!" made-for-TV movie and subsequent series before retiring from the public eye, but it's tough not to focus on Carol Channing's huge white afro.
